I build a bios from EDKII that set the OsIndicationsSupported to 0x1f for QEMU.
This could be used to reproduced this issue on QEMU.

Bug description:
Some new Bios would like to support the new feature,capsule update, on UEFI spec. 2.4b.
So the UEFI variable OsIndicationsSupported will be set as 0x1F on Bios, this causes the update-grub fail, also Ubuntu installation fail.
$ sudo update-grub
Generating grub configuration file ...
Warning: Setting GRUB_TIMEOUT to a non-zero value when GRUB_HIDDEN_TIMEOUT is set is no longer supported.
Found linux image: /boot/vmlinuz-3.19.0-16-generic
Found initrd image: /boot/initrd.img-3.19.0-16-generic
Found linux image: /boot/vmlinuz-3.19.0-15-generic
Found initrd image: /boot/initrd.img-3.19.0-15-generic
/etc/grub.d/30_uefi-firmware: 34: /etc/grub.d/30_uefi-firmware: arithmetic expression: expecting EOF: " 1f & 1 "
